Why UK Businesses are Opting for Accounting Outsourcing?

Accounting outsourcing has become an increasingly popular and common practice among UK businesses in recent years. This means outsourcing their accounting tasks to a third-party service provider instead of managing them in-house. There are several reasons why businesses are choosing to outsource their accounting, and in this blog post, we will discuss some of the main benefits and advantages that come with this practice.

  1. Cost Savings

One key factor that drives businesses to opt for accounting outsourcing is the potential cost savings. By outsourcing accounting tasks, companies can save significant money on the expenses associated with hiring, training, and maintaining an in-house accounting team. They no longer have to cover the costs of salaries, benefits, office space, and equipment. Furthermore, outsourcing allows businesses to pay only for the services they need, eliminating the need for a fixed salary or hourly pay for an in-house team.

  1. Expertise and Efficiency

Outsourcing accounting tasks means that businesses have access to a team of highly skilled and experienced accounting professionals. These service providers have a dedicated team of experts knowledgeable in various accounting practices and can provide diverse services. This expertise can be particularly beneficial for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) that may not have the resources to hire a full-time experienced accountant. By outsourcing, businesses can also ensure that their accounting tasks are managed efficiently and accurately, helping them save time and streamline their processes.

  1. Time-SavingĀ 

Accounting tasks can be time-consuming and require in-depth knowledge and attention to detail. By outsourcing these tasks, businesses can free up their time and focus on other core activities such as business development and growth. This can be especially beneficial for SMEs, as it allows them to focus on their core competencies without worrying about managing and maintaining their accounting records. It also eliminates the need for businesses to invest time and resources in training their staff on accounting practices.

  1. Access to the Latest Technology

Outsourcing accounting also means access to the latest accounting software and technology. Using advanced accounting tools and software, service providers can process and manage accounting tasks more efficiently and accurately. This can help businesses stay updated with their financial records and make better-informed decisions based on real-time data. Additionally, outsourcing eliminates the need for companies to invest in expensive accounting software and keep up with regular updates and upgrades.

  1. Improved Data Security

Outsourcing accounting tasks to a reputable third-party service provider can also offer businesses improved data security. These providers must follow strict regulations and maintain the confidentiality and security of their clients’ data. This means that companies can rest assured their financial data is in safe hands. In addition, many outsourcing companies have in place strict security measures and backup processes to ensure the protection and availability of their clients’ financial records.

  1. Scalability

Outsourcing also allows businesses to scale their accounting needs as their business grows. As businesses expand, their financial transactions and accounting requirements also increase. Outsourcing allows them to easily adjust their services and scale up their needs without the added burden of recruiting and training new employees. This can help businesses stay agile and adaptable in a constantly changing business landscape.

  1. Compliance and Accuracy

One of the main concerns for businesses regarding accounting is compliance with tax laws and regulations. Outsourcing accounting tasks to professionals who are well-versed in tax laws and regulations can help businesses meet their legal obligations and avoid potential penalties. Outsourcing also reduces the risk of errors and inaccuracies in financial records, as experienced professionals manage the accounting tasks.
